(2)
The master of every vessel or the pilot of every aircraft, or his agent leaving any customs airport, customs port or entry or exit point shall submit to the proper officer of customs a list of the passengers and crews—
(a)
in the case of a vessel, not less than twenty-four hours before departure; and
(b)
in the case of an aircraft, not less than two hours before departure.
(3)
The carrier in charge of every train or the operator of a bus, or his agent, arriving at or leaving any customs airport, customs port or entry or exit point shall submit to the proper officer of customs a list of the passengers and crews as and when directed by such proper officer of customs.
